AGARTALA, July 9 (TIWN): With the aim to safeguard the forest resources in the area, a new Range Office building of Forest Department at Kamalghat will be inaugurated on July 9.
Beside the inauguration of the Range Office, a Mohanpur block level Van Mahotsav will also be celebrated on the same day at the premises of Higher Secondary School of Kamalghat.
Forest and Rural Development Minister Naresh Chandra Jamatia is expected to raise the curtain of the Range office in the presence of Sabadhipati of West Tripura District Council Dilip Kumar Das.
To make the programme colourful and blissful, a pleasant cultural evening will also be organized.
It is expected that the programme will start in the evening.
Forest range officers are responsible for managing the forests, environment and wildlife-related issues of a forest range within a state or Union Territory of India. The officer is assisted by other state forest officials including subordinate forest beat officers (also known as Forest Guards) and Forest Section Officers (also known as Forester/Round Officer).
Forest Range Officers hold an important role in India. They are responsible to safeguard the forest resources in their range.
Forest Range Officer is the officer in executive charge of the Range and he or she is responsible for the efficient management of the Range, for the custody and condition of all Government Property in his charge and for the discipline, conduct and work of all his subordinate staff.
